· Stanpa with the support of ICEX (Institute for Foreign Trade), organizes for the first time a Spanish Pavilion in the international trade fair, Personal Care and Homecare Ingredients in China.
· The Spanish companies: INFINITEC, LLUCH and SAFEQUIM will launch their last novelties in cosmetics ingredients, raw materials and active ingredients.
· The show will be held in Shanghai World Expo Exhibition and Convention Center in February, 26 to 28. There are expected more than 30,000 attendees from 80 countries all around the globe and more than 650 exhibiting companies.
· Spain Is withing the ranking of the TOP 10 beauty exporting countries worldwide and is ranked the 2nd for perfumes.
Beauty traditionally have played a key role in Spanish lifestyle and wellness. In Spain, a bright and sunny country, companies have long produced skin care products, color cosmetics, perfumes and hair care products. Therefore, Spanish companies have specialized themselves in manufacturing cosmetics ingredients and essentials oils to provide a greater added value to cosmetics Made in Spain. Spain reinforces their image as global beauty leader, with an increase of 8,4% among the exports of essentials oils.
The perfumery and cosmetic sector is one of the industries that invest more in innovation, for that matter the development of cosmetic ingredients is one of the fundamental pillars in Spanish industry. The constant research in innovation, enable a quick implementation and adaptation according to the consumers’ needs. 1 out of every 3 products launched by companies in the industry have been reformulated in the last two years incorporating, among others, new ingredients. In Spain, 881 patents were published in the last year.
Spain is a Global Beauty Leader, characterized for high quality, innovation and competitiveness, our products meet the highest European Standards and GMP procedures. Spain exports more than €4.3 billion in cosmetics and perfumes, with an increase of 10%. China is the first destination for skin care cosmetics, with over €200 million exported in 2019.
